dinkslayer Posted December 16, 2018 Author Report Share Posted December 16, 2018 I need to add more soft plastics to my game for sure. I have been focusing on wakebaits and glide baits so far. Glide baits are amazing, I love the way they make big bass come out of their hiding places. 5s and 6s will swim to within 3ft of your kayak completely keyed on your bait. I dont want to recommend any specific baits because theyre all expensive.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
